public/Environment/Publish-FabricEnvironment.ps1
<#
.SYNOPSIS Publishes a staging environment in a specified Microsoft Fabric workspace. .DESCRIPTION This function interacts with the Microsoft Fabric API to initiate the publishing process for a staging environment. It validates the authentication token, constructs the API request, and handles both immediate and long-running operations. .PARAMETER WorkspaceId The unique identifier of the workspace containing the staging environment. .PARAMETER EnvironmentId The unique identifier of the staging environment to be published. .EXAMPLE Publish-FabricEnvironment -WorkspaceId "workspace-12345" -EnvironmentId "environment-67890" Initiates the publishing process for the specified staging environment. .NOTES - Requires the `$FabricConfig` global object, including `BaseUrl` and `FabricHeaders`. - Uses `Test-TokenExpired` to validate the token before making API calls. Author: Tiago Balabuch #> function Publish-FabricEnvironment { [CmdletBinding()] param ( [Parameter(Mandatory = $true)] [ValidateNotNullOrEmpty()] [string]$WorkspaceId, [Parameter(Mandatory = $true)] [ValidateNotNullOrEmpty()] [string]$EnvironmentId ) try { # Step 1: Ensure token validity Write-Message -Message "Validating token..." -Level Debug Test-TokenExpired Write-Message -Message "Token validation completed." -Level Debug # Step 2: Construct the API URL $apiEndpointUrl = "{0}/workspaces/{1}/environments/{2}/staging/publish" -f $FabricConfig.BaseUrl, $WorkspaceId, $EnvironmentId Write-Message -Message "API Endpoint: $apiEndpointUrl" -Level Debug # Step 3: Make the API request $response = Invoke-RestMethod ` -Headers $FabricConfig.FabricHeaders ` -Uri $apiEndpointUrl ` -Method Post ` -Body $bodyJson ` -ContentType "application/json" ` -ErrorAction Stop ` -SkipHttpErrorCheck ` -ResponseHeadersVariable "responseHeader" ` -StatusCodeVariable "statusCode" # Step 4: Handle and log the response switch ($statusCode) { 200 { Write-Message -Message "Publish operation request has been submitted successfully for the environment '$EnvironmentId'!" -Level Info return $response.publishDetails } 202 { Write-Message -Message "Publish operation accepted. Publishing in progress!" -Level Info [string]$operationId = $responseHeader["x-ms-operation-id"] Write-Message -Message "Operation ID: '$operationId'" -Level Debug Write-Message -Message "Getting Long Running Operation status" -Level Debug $operationStatus = Get-FabricLongRunningOperation -operationId $operationId Write-Message -Message "Long Running Operation status: $operationStatus" -Level Debug # Handle operation result if ($operationStatus.status -eq "Succeeded") { Write-Message -Message "Operation Succeeded" -Level Debug Write-Message -Message "Getting Long Running Operation result" -Level Debug $operationResult = Get-FabricLongRunningOperationResult -operationId $operationId Write-Message -Message "Long Running Operation status: $operationResult" -Level Debug return $operationResult } else { Write-Message -Message "Operation failed. Status: $($operationStatus)" -Level Debug Write-Message -Message "Operation failed. Status: $($operationStatus)" -Level Error return $operationStatus } } default { Write-Message -Message "Unexpected response code: $statusCode" -Level Error Write-Message -Message "Error details: $($response.message)" -Level Error throw "API request failed with status code $statusCode." } } } catch { # Step 6: Handle and log errors $errorDetails = $_.Exception.Message Write-Message -Message "Failed to create environment. Error: $errorDetails" -Level Error } } |
